Re: GDEMU
Posted: Sat Apr 05, 2014 3:27 pm
by noiseredux
Jagosaurus wrote:Is this different than the SD loaders I've seen other places floating around?
yes. Apparently this tricks the system into thinking the ROMs are a GDROM. Apparently there's issues w/ some games because of the amt of RAM that can be loaded or speed of the serial port. So basically, this is damn close to a legit DC HDD. It's a great idea, but I'll need to wait a bit before being convinced I'd need one.

Re: GDEMU
Posted: Sun Apr 06, 2014 2:27 am
by KalessinDB
I'm on the list for one. I currently have a region modded DC with the (bad/slow) internal SD card mod, and intend to pick up a virgin DC as well. This is supposed to be plug and play replacement of the GD-ROM, so I should be able to try it in both easily enough. Will happily provide feedback when I get it/when it comes in.
Only thing that kinda makes me sad is how he said there's not going to be a ribbon cable

BUT! He did say there would be pads for adding on buttons if you want... so I can do that, and then dx.com has an SD card extender, so I can just get one of those and mount it under the disc lid easily enough. Taking the top off the console to switch SD cards/games was not going to make me happy, but I think I can fix that problem that way.
Edit: Also, not quite as sleek as the 3DO USB reader (I have that too) -- limited in size (he says SDHC only, not SDXC, and claims to have added an arbitrary 40 file limit because larger means the FAT sorting would slow it down too far), and it appears to be a less full-featured "OS" for selecting games. Still awesome though, and I still jumped at the chance to get on the pre-order list.
